Learning Objectives: 

  • Recognize the downstream impacts of false-positive blood cultures with focus on antibiotic stewardship and prevention of patient harm.
  • Understand the impacts of false-positive blood cultures on the Laboratory, ED and Inpatient units.
  • Describe the impacts of false-positive blood cultures on publicly reported CLABSI events.
  • Review intervention methods that have attempted to reduce blood culture contamination.
  • Learn of an evidence-based technology solution that addresses blood culture diagnostic accuracy and clinical decision making.
